Karen answered Thursday March 24 2005, 3:10 pm:
If you want to prevent yourself from getting ingrown hairs when you shave, you need to use a good razor such as from Venus or Gilette and use shaving cream. Just shave slowly and in the direction that your hair grows in and apply lotion or aftershave when you are done. The main key is to just shave slowly with a good razor.
